2006 Alfa Romeo 159 vs. 1989 Toyota 4Runner
To start off, 2006 Alfa Romeo 159 is newer by 17 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1989 Toyota 4Runner.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1989 Toyota 4Runner would be higher. At 3,200 cc (6 cylinders), 2006 Alfa Romeo 159 is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2006 Alfa Romeo 159 (260 HP) has 148 more horse power than 1989 Toyota 4Runner. (112 HP). In normal driving conditions, 2006 Alfa Romeo 159 should accelerate faster than 1989 Toyota 4Runner.
Because 1989 Toyota 4Runner is four wheel drive (4WD), it will have significant more traction and grip than 2006 Alfa Romeo 159. In wet, icy, snow, or gravel driving conditions, 1989 Toyota 4Runner will offer significantly more control.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 2006 Alfa Romeo 159 (322 Nm) has 130 more torque (in Nm) than 1989 Toyota 4Runner. (192 Nm). This means 2006 Alfa Romeo 159 will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1989 Toyota 4Runner.
